Feature branches # are gated via `pull_request` instead. Running both on a push to a PR'd # branch was pure duplication on Gitea: unlike GitHub it has no merge- # preview ref — its `pull_request` checks out `refs/pull/N/head`, the same # commit a branch push would, so the two runs were byte-identical # (docs.gitea.com/usage/actions/faq). Gating on `pull_request` is also # forward-compatible: if Gitea ever adds the merge ref, these runs upgrade # to testing the merged result for free.
